The True Story Behind Lyle and Erik Menendez: A Tale of Privilege, Lies, and a Shocking Crime

The Menendez brothers, Lyle and Erik, were once the epitome of California wealth and privilege. Their seemingly perfect life, however, was shattered in August 1989 when their parents, Jose and Kitty Menendez, were brutally murdered in their Beverly Hills mansion. This heinous act sent shockwaves through the country, and what followed was one of the most sensational trials in American history.

The Crime and the Initial Cover-Up

On August 20, 1989, Jose and Kitty Menendez were found dead in their home, each shot multiple times. Initially, the police believed the murders were a random act of violence. However, suspicion quickly fell on the brothers, who had claimed they were at a movie theater at the time of the crime.

The brothers' initial story unravelled as inconsistencies emerged. They seemed to have an excessive amount of cash, had recently purchased luxury items, and were spending lavishly. The police also discovered evidence of a potential motive: the brothers were allegedly unhappy with their parents' strict control over their lives and finances.

The Confession and the Trial

After months of investigation, Lyle and Erik were arrested and charged with the murders. During questioning, they confessed to the crime, claiming they had been physically and psychologically abused by their father for years. They also alleged that their mother had been aware of the abuse and had done nothing to stop it.

The trial began in 1993 and quickly captivated the nation. The brothers' lawyers used the defense of "diminished capacity" arguing that their history of abuse had impaired their ability to understand the consequences of their actions. The prosecution, however, presented evidence of the brothers' elaborate scheme, pointing out their deliberate actions to cover up the crime and their lavish spending after the murders.

The Verdict and the Aftermath

After a long and intense trial, the jury failed to reach a verdict. A retrial was held in 1994, and this time, the brothers were convicted of murder and sentenced to life in prison without the possibility of parole.
